Empress Royalty Completes Acquisition of 14-Asset Royalty Portfolio
Empress Royalty Corp. has completed its acquisition of a portfolio of 14 pre-production net smelter return (NSR) royalties from Almadex Minerals Ltd. The transaction, which follows a purchase agreement signed on July 9, 2026, has secured all required corporate and regulatory approvals, including sign-off from the TSX Venture Exchange.
The deal grants Empress expanded exposure to mineral properties located across Canada, the United States, and Mexico. These royalty interests are supported by a group of established project operators, including Alamos Gold, McEwen Inc., Kodiak Copper, and Westhaven Gold.
As part of the consideration for the acquisition, Empress has issued common shares to Almadex. These shares are now subject to a statutory hold period of four months and one day under applicable Canadian securities laws. Empress currently holds approximately US$20 million in cash, gold, and silver, which it maintains to fund further opportunities throughout the mining lifecycle.
“Closing this acquisition has expanded our exposure to exploration and development assets, added long-term optionality and exposure to future discoveries and project advancement alongside our cash generating assets at the foundation of our business.”
— Alexandra Woodyer Sherron, CEO and President
